The former Vice President of Nigeria, Abubakar Atiku, on Saturday admonished Nigerians to extend love to their neighbours during this yultide season.

He made this call in his Christmas message which he shared across his social media platforms.

Emphasising on the essence of the celebration, the former Presidential aspirant noted that Nigerians should trust God for a better tomorrow.

He said, “Christmas is a time of love, therefore, I call on all Nigerians to emulate the essence of this season and unite for the greater good of our dear country.

“We should continue to extend hands of love and fellowship to our neighbours and live as one big family, irrespective of our social,  political and religious leanings and continue to trust God for a better tomorrow and a greater country.”
